Is there any instance in which we here at Super Empty wouldn’t throw our endorsement behind a bill, introduced by a North Carolina politician, intended to champion working musicians?

That was the question raised last week when the office of got in touch about a new bill called the Protect Working Musicians Act, and sought our help with amplification. This may not be the approach that all would want to take, and undoubtedly some of our artist friends, in dire need of a more equitable pay structure with streaming companies, will find it to be a fight not worth having. But in 2026, to address one injustice while fueling an even greater one feels like treading water in a moment that demands drastic, radical change.

In this week’s very atypical SE newsletter, a reminder that art is not just about amplifying, but also about truth-telling. And if a politician wants help with the former, they’d better be prepared for the latter, too.

NEW EVENT 🌐 Join us Wednesday, June 10 as Charlotte rapper Lord Jah-Monte Ogbon continues his run of vinyl listening sessions for his latest album, “As Of Now,” with a stop in Durham at !

We’ll be playing the album in full, followed by a Q&A with SE contributor Dash Lewis , who also reviewed the album for Pitchfork earlier this year (where it earned the distinction of Best New Music).

Tunes, complimentary drinks/water, merch, DJing by , friends new and old. RSVP and we’ll see you there.

Earlier this month, Phuzz Phest descended on downtown Winston-Salem for the first time in a decade, and SE contributor was there to take it all in. Her impressions? Even after all that time away, organizers hardly missed a beat. More than sound logistical ex*****on and quality music, Phuzz served up what downtown, multi-venue festival should aspire to: a momentary, community-oriented suspension of reality. At the link in bio, read about a weekend on which every choice is the right one, time is merely a construct, and the wandering is half the point.
